KST63MTF is a versatile electronic component that belongs to the category of semiconductor devices. This product is widely used in various electronic applications due to its unique characteristics and functional features.
The KST63MTF transistor has three pins: 1. Collector (C): Connected to the positive supply voltage. 2. Base (B): Input terminal for controlling the transistor's conductivity. 3. Emitter (E): Output terminal through which the amplified signal is obtained.
The KST63MTF operates based on the principles of bipolar junction transistors. When a small current flows into the base terminal, it controls a much larger current flowing between the collector and emitter terminals, allowing for signal amplification or switching.
The KST63MTF is commonly used in the following applications: - Audio Amplifiers - Sensor Interface Circuits - Oscillator Circuits - Digital Logic Gates
